Transaction 80ac950aa3f0c0d633de7eea8d7e127c8577e76de54e0e3e63b08f09a12e3624
1 Input
1 Outputs
- 80ac950aa3f0c0d633de7eea8d7e127c8577e76de54e0e3e63b08f09a12e3624:0
value 5714427
address 32QxqjTJftdVv1DffT3Vv1gYBARpGYWeHo